'''WCCW''' is an American ([[FM Broadcasting|FM]]) [[radio station]] licensed by the [[Federal Communications Commission|FCC]] to serve the community of [[Traverse City, Michigan]] on the frequency of 107.5 [[Megahertz|MHz]] . The station license is assigned to WCCW Radio, Inc. WCCW-FM) airs a [[Classic Hits]] format.
The [[FCC]] first licensed this station to begin operations on May 29, 1979 using callsign WCCW-FM.<ref name=fcchistory>{{cite web|url=https://licensing.fcc.gov/cgi-bin/prod/cdbs/forms/prod/getimportletter_exh.cgi?import_letter_id=80360|publisher=Federal Communications Commission|title=FCC History card for WCCW-FM}}</ref>
